1. Exposure to Sunlight

On a hot day, a room with lots of windows are like greenhouses, trapping more heat in your apartment coming from the direct sun above. To counteract this, your HVAC system must work harder prevent your apartment from becoming too hot. This, then makes your energy bills skyrocket. Your best bet is to install window treatments such as draperies. If your curtains and blinds are heavy, this will help keep most sunlight out.

3. The Thermostat isn’t Placed Correctly

The AC unit works by sensing the room’s temperature and adjusting its settings to ensure your apartment is not too hot. If the thermometer reads the ideal temperature, the central and air conditioning unit will turn off (or on).

To get accurate temperature readings, you need to place the thermostat in the right place.

It’s not a smart idea to put your thermostat in close proximity to where people are cooking or doing laundry. For obvious reasons, you should not put your thermostat close to windows that will draw direct sunlight.

A more intelligent solution to the problem is to purchase a smart thermostat. These devices are more powerful and affordable than they were in the past.

Smart thermostats use your past preferences to learn what temperature you like and adjust the temperature accordingly. This allows your smart thermostat to be able to keep your apartment cooler, and also do this efficiently.

You can control smart thermostats through apps. This means if you’re not at home, you can adjust the temperature from wherever you are.

6. You Are Running Too Many Heat Emitting Appliances

Sometimes your apartment can get really hot because of the appliances you are using. Computers, generators, space heaters, or iron boxes are some appliances that might crank up the apartment temperature. Ensure to turn off these devices where possible.

Your lights also give off heat, so instead you could use LED lights which emit a lot less heat. Your large bulbs will be heating up your apartment unnecessarily.

8. Damaged Duct-work

A lot of HVAC systems have a form of duct-work responsible for circulating the cold air down through your apartment. Duct-work is liable to wear and tear, which is usually because of damage. The damage can be made worse by dust, mold, leaks, and pests (such as ants, and rodents. Because of this, the cool air filters through and leaves the duct-work before it circulates through your apartment.

9. Lots of People Living in your Apartment

If there’s more than 2 people living in your small apartment, it’s likely the heat in your apartment is going to increase. This is because people give off body heat, which means more hot air gets trapped in your apartment. More people could also mean an increase in the frequency that the oven and stove are used, which are appliances that generate a lot of heat.
